#a206e2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a206e2 is composed of 63.5% red, 2.4%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.3% cyan, 97.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 282.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 45.5%. #a206e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#4500c5.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

#a206e2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a206e2 has RGB values of R:162, G:6,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 10618594.

Hex triplet a206e2 #a206e2
RGB Decimal 162, 6, 226 rgb(162,6,226)
RGB Percent 63.5, 2.4, 88.6 rgb(63.5%,2.4%,88.6%)
CMYK 28, 97, 0, 11
HSL 282.5°, 94.8, 45.5 hsl(282.5,94.8%,45.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 282.5°, 97.3, 88.6
Web Safe 9900cc #9900cc
CIE-LAB 43.217, 80.161, -72.95
XYZ 28.691, 13.304, 73.004
xyY 0.249, 0.116, 13.304
CIE-LCH 43.217, 108.386, 317.696
CIE-LUV 43.217, 33.011, -112.72
Hunter-Lab 36.474, 76.581, -93.139
Binary 10100010, 00000110, 11100010

Shades and Tints of #a206e2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0010 is the darkest color, while #fefcff is the lightest one.
